我的应用程序中有一个主类。 我在全局声明了ftp类,当我调试代码时,我将得到“源未找到”错误。 如果我在按钮单击事件内声明。我不会收到此错误。任何人都可以告诉我如何声明全局类?
public class MainActivity extends Activity {
final ftpfunctions ftpclass=new ftpfunctions ();
//code here
Buttonclickevent{
ftpclass.connect();
}
}
即使我在另一个类文件中声明了一个api,我也会得到同样的错误。
public class ftpfunctions extends AsyncTask<String, Integer, String> {
FTPClient ftpClient;
public void connectFTP(){
try {
ftpClient= new FTPClient();
ftpClient.connect("myap");
ftpClient.enterLocalPassiveMode();
ftpClient.login("123", "123");
} catch (IOException e) {
e.printStackTrace(); }
} }